贴片机编程可以使用多种软件,具体选择哪种软件取决于贴片机的类型、品牌以及用户的需求。以下是几种常用的贴片机编程软件:
JTAG烧录工具
Xilinx ISE:用于Xilinx FPGA的编程。
Altera Quartus:用于Altera FPGA的编程。
ARM Keil:用于ARM处理器的编程。
ISP烧录工具
AVR Studio:用于AVR系列单片机的编程。
ST-Link:用于STMicroelectronics微控制器的编程。
PICkit:用于PIC系列单片机的编程。
GUI编程工具
Arduino IDE:用于Arduino单片机的编程。
MPLAB X IDE:用于Microchip PIC系列单片机的编程。
嵌入式开发环境
Keil MDK:用于ARM Cortex-M系列单片机的编程。
IAR Embedded Workbench:用于多种嵌入式系统平台的编程。
GCC:GNU编译器集合,用于多种嵌入式系统的编程。
专用贴片机编程软件
Siemens Siplace Pro:西门子公司提供的贴片机编程软件。
VayoPro-SMT Expert:望友SMT智能贴片编程软件,提供智能化编程方案。
Ucamco:提供Frontline CAM、GerbTool等软件,用于PCB制造过程中的布局和生产。
Altium Designer:综合性的电子设计自动化软件,支持多种贴片机的编程。
Mentor Graphics PADS:专业的PCB设计软件,支持贴片机编程。
Cadence Allegro:强大的PCB设计工具,支持贴片机编程。
ASM Assembly:德国ASM公司开发的贴片机编程软件。
第三方软件
WinCC:西门子公司的软件,适用于Siemens贴片机。
GX Works2:Mitsubishi公司的软件,适用于Mitsubishi贴片机。
建议
选择贴片机编程软件时,建议考虑以下因素:
贴片机的类型和品牌:确保选择的软件与您的贴片机兼容。
功能需求:根据您的具体需求选择具有相应功能的软件,如智能化编程、自动校正、数据互转等。
用户界面:选择界面友好、易于使用的软件,以提高编程效率。
成本:考虑软件的购买成本和维护成本。
通过以上信息,您可以根据自己的实际情况选择最适合的贴片机编程软件。